About

Sculpture artist Anna Chromy's "Il Commendatore," or "Cloak of Conscience," sits outside of the historic Estates Theatre in Prague. Though the sculpture was created as a symbol for hope and peace, it's allegedly haunted: visitors have claimed faces in the figure's empty cloak have appeared in photos that have used flash photography.  

The piece was created by the Czechian artist Anna Chromy. The original model was originally sourced from white marble from the same quarry as Michelangelo's David, in Carrara, Italy.
